The Taipei Times is one of the three major English-language newspapers in the Republic of China (Taiwan) the other two being the Taiwan News and The China Post. Established in 1999, the Taipei Times is published by the Liberty Times Group, which publishes the Chinese language newspaper the Liberty Times which has a pro-Taiwan independence editorial line.[1]
Along with such newspapers as The Guardian, it is a participant of Project Syndicate, established by George Soros.
